Transaction 598db23c576f2c3726bb6fe660161e34906a954f01a0839e100f7f669076a22d

1 Input
2 Outputs
  • 598db23c576f2c3726bb6fe660161e34906a954f01a0839e100f7f669076a22d:0
  • value  2508400
    address  1De65ve79BafoxfhPmZtf3pqXkcdsGSkb
  • 598db23c576f2c3726bb6fe660161e34906a954f01a0839e100f7f669076a22d:1
  • value  30514392
    address  1EU3p3K6bZ4w11TQrBE2ZQAc8dfZz8P3Cf